Feel free to write if you have any questions. This captivating vintage linen postcard showcases the majestic Wisconsin State Capitol building in Madison, Wisconsin. The vibrant 'Art-Colortone' printing technique, a hallmark of Curt Teich, brings to life the architectural grandeur of the dome and surrounding grounds, complete with American flags proudly displayed. The distinctive linen texture adds a tactile quality, characteristic of postcards from the early to mid-20th century. The reverse side provides intriguing facts about the Capitol's dome, noting its impressive height and construction costs, a testament to its engineering marvel. Published by E. A. Bishop of Racine, Wisconsin, and printed by C.T. Art-Colortone, this piece offers a glimpse into the historical significance and enduring beauty of one of Wisconsin's most iconic landmarks, making it a valuable addition for collectors of Wisconsiniana, architectural history, or vintage travel memorabilia.
